Evaporator Fan (cont.)
Yellow Wire (Signal)
The yellow wire is the input wire from the main control board. The main control
board provides 6.5 VDC effective voltage for low speed, 8 VDC effective voltage
for medium speed, and 9.5 VDC effective voltage for high speed. The fan
operates in low speed only when the fresh food thermistor is satisfied.
Note: When testing these motors:
You cannot test with an ohmmeter.
DC common is not AC common.
Verify 2 voltage potentials:
a. Red to white - power for internal controller (13.7 VDC)
b. Yellow to white - power for fan (5.5 to 12 VDC)
Observe circuit polarity.
Motors can be run for short periods using a 9 volt battery. Connect the white
wire to the negative (-) battery terminal only. Connect the red and yellow wires
to the positive (+) battery terminal.
